Algebra Tutor Lesson Plan (Middle & High School Students)
Schedule: 3 Days per Week
Session Length: 1 Hour per Session
Day 1: Foundations and Skill Building
Objective: Strengthen understanding of core algebra concepts.
Session Outline (60 minutes):
10 min: Review previous lesson and warm-up problems
20 min: Introduce or review key concept (e.g., variables, expressions, solving one-step equations)
20 min: Guided practice with examples
10 min: Independent practice and recap
Skills Covered:
Order of operations
Variables and expressions
Solving equations
Integers and fractions
Basic graphing
Day 2: Application and Problem Solving
Objective: Apply algebra concepts to more complex problems.
Session Outline (60 minutes):
10 min: Quick review and assessment questions
20 min: Instruction on new topic (e.g., multi-step equations, inequalities, functions)
20 min: Real-world and word problem practice
10 min: Error analysis and discussion
Skills Covered:
Multi-step equations
Inequalities
Ratios and proportions
Function notation
Word problems
Day 3: Reinforcement and Assessment
Objective: Build confidence through practice and evaluate mastery.
Session Outline (60 minutes):
15 min: Comprehensive review of week's topics
25 min: Mixed practice problems and challenge questions
10 min: Quiz or informal assessment
10 min: Feedback, goal setting, and homework support
Skills Covered:
Review of all current topics
Test-taking strategies
Critical thinking and problem-solving
Preparation for quizzes, tests, and standardized exams
Expected Outcomes
Students will:
Improve algebra problem-solving skills.
Develop confidence in mathematics.
Strengthen critical thinking and analytical reasoning.
Improve classroom performance and test scores.
Build a solid foundation for advanced mathematics courses.
